Modena beat Mantova 2-1 at Stadio Alberto Braglia, Regular Season - 32, in the Serie B. That is the final score; the rest of this report grades it against what the data forecast beforehand.
The Model vs The Result
The Poisson model went into this projecting Modena 1.38 xG and Mantova 0.86 xG, a combined 2.24. The scoreboard read 2-1 for 3 actual goals. Both sides finished within a goal of their individual projections, so the scoreline sat close to the model's expected shape. Those figures were built on strength ratings of Modena attack 0.91 / defence 0.89 against Mantova attack 0.88 / defence 1.11, drawn from 68/69 games (CurrentSeason).
On the result, the model split it Modena 47% | Draw 30% | Mantova 22%, with Modena to win its most likely call at 47%. The scoreboard confirmed the model's leading pick.
